Worth it

techbinkon 23/07/2016 18:46

Stayed here for a week whilst sightseeing in Berlin. The ground floor Apartment consists of 4 individually lockable bedrooms, a kitchen, a shower and toilet and another toilet. Everything was clean and serviceable. The shower, toilets and kitchen (inc bins) were well cleaned every day by the owners. The bedrooms were simple and airy, three double bedded and one with 3 singles; they were comfortable, linen and towels were provided. You rent the rooms you require and share the common areas with others who rent the remaining room/s. This happened with us and wasn't a problem. The owners are Eco and cost conscious thus there are separate bins for different waste, timer on the hall lights and a push button shower which gives 20 secs of hot water before pressing again as many times as you want ..... this works well and hot water was plentiful ( could save a fortune at home ).The owners ask that you respect the need for a lower noise level at night and and all seem to observe this in the apartment block. Other reviews have mentioned the graffiti outside and are correct in saying it shouldn't put you off ; graffiti is endemic in Berlin regardless of area or community. Downsides - the kitchen is too small to use as a lounge so if a number of you want to chill together you either have to use a bedroom, the small common access courtyard out back or go out.... not a big problem, oh, and if you want to lie in be aware 3 of the rooms are adjacent to the street and occasionally it can get noisy after 8:00 am. It is a great place as a base for exploring Berlin, five minutes from trains, underground, trams and buses. There's supermarkets, restaurants, bars and late shops all within 5 minutes walk. Owners are helpful and efficient. For the room price I can't see a better way to stay in Berlin - recommended.
